验证 PHP 中 PDO 的可用性
问题:
如何确定 PHP 数据是否可用对象 (PDO) 是否已正确配置并可在我的托管平台上与 MySQL 一起使用?
答案:
方法 1:使用 phpinfo()
PDO 是 PHP 5.1 及更高版本的组成部分。要验证其是否存在,可以使用以下命令:
<code class="php">phpinfo();</code>
这将显示所有加载的 PHP 扩展的列表,包括 PDO。
方法 2:检查特定 PDO驱动程序
特定数据库驱动程序需要某些 PHP 扩展。您可以使用以下常量检查 MySQL PDO 驱动程序是否存在:
<code class="php">var_dump(defined(PDO::MYSQL_ATTR_LOCAL_INFILE));</code>
方法 3:使用命令行
您可以检查可用性使用以下命令从命令行加载 PDO:
$ php -m
这将显示所有加载的 PHP 模块的列表,包括 PDO。
方法 4:使用 PHP 扩展函数
或者,您可以使用以下功能:
<code class="php">extension_loaded('PDO'); // Returns boolean extension_loaded('pdo_mysql'); // Returns boolean</code>
您还可以获取所有加载的 PHP 扩展的列表并搜索“PDO”或“pdo_mysql”。
注意:并非所有 PDO 驱动程序都定义了特定常量,这使得 phpinfo() 成为最可靠的选项。
以上是如何在 PHP 中检查 PDO 是否正确配置并适用于 MySQL?的详细内容。更多信息请关注PHP中文网其他相关文章!